Abstract

A petroleum pipeline necking jig comprises a fixed part and a movable part, wherein the fixed part comprises a lower jig and lower jig moving blocks, the lower jig is in an arc shape, the left side the right side of the lower jig are respectively provided with a lower jig moving block, the lower jig and the two lower jig moving blocks together form a semi-circle, and limit grooves are arranged in the front faces of the lower jig moving blocks. The movable part comprises an upper jig and upper jig moving blocks, the upper jig is the same as the lower jig in structure, the upper jig moving blocks are the same as the lower jig moving blocks in structure, the semi-circular fixed part and the semi-circular movable part form a circle, and the moving part is arranged on the fixed part. Concentric circular protrusions of the lower jig moving blocks are clamped in concentric circular grooves of the upper jig moving blocks, and concentric circular protrusions of the upper jig moving blocks are clamped in concentric circular grooves of the lower jig moving blocks. A cylinder only controls the movable part to vertically move, and therefore control is simple.

Technical field
The utility model relates to the steel pipe's production manufacture field, particularly a kind of petroleum pipeline reducing anchor clamps.
Background technology
In the process of manufacture of petroleum pipeline, need handle the port of petroleum pipeline, this just need fix petroleum pipeline, the fixing general anchor clamps that adopt of petroleum pipeline fix, for fixing of bigbore petroleum pipeline, it is a difficult problem of production and processing pipeline always, existing technology generally is the branch anchor clamps with six arcs, form toroidal, draw close to pipeline from six direction respectively, reach the purpose of fixed-piping, such mode, the control system complexity, and six arc fixed supports bed knife that pipeline is applied differ to, can have influence on the ovality of pipeline.
Summary of the invention
The purpose of this utility model is to overcome the above-mentioned deficiency of prior art and a kind of petroleum pipeline reducing anchor clamps are provided, and it is the anchor stone oil-piping easily, and does not influence the ovality of petroleum pipeline.

The specific embodiment
As shown in drawings: a kind of petroleum pipeline reducing anchor clamps, it comprises standing part and movable part.
Described standing part comprises: lower clamp 1, lower clamp movable block 2, lower clamp 1 is a circular shape, two limits respectively are equipped with a lower clamp movable block 2 about lower clamp 1, lower clamp 1 and semi-circular shape of two lower clamp movable block 2 common formation, have fixedly aperture 1-1 of a plurality of lower clamps on the lower clamp 1, the intrados of lower clamp 1 partly is following big, above little shape, the intrados part is by lower clamp orthodrome 1-3, lower clamp roundlet arc 1-4 and lower clamp transition arcs 1-2 form, be connected with lower clamp transition arcs 1-2 between lower clamp orthodrome 1-3 and the lower clamp roundlet arc 1-4, have locating hole 1-5 on lower clamp 1 and the lower clamp movable block 2 contacted planes, the front of lower clamp movable block 2 has limited impression 2-1, movable block projection 2-4 is arranged on the joint face of lower clamp movable block 2 and lower clamp 1, movable block projection 2-4 is cylindrical, on the columniform movable block projection 2-4 spring 5 is installed, movable block projection 2-4 and spring 5 are installed in the locating hole 1-5, and concentric circles projection 2-2 is arranged on the last plane of lower clamp movable block 2, concentric circles groove 2-3.
Described movable part comprises: go up anchor clamps 4, go up anchor clamps movable block 3, the structure of last anchor clamps 4 is finished identical with the structure of lower clamp 1, the structure of last anchor clamps movable block 3 is finished identical with the structure of lower clamp movable block 2, two limits respectively are equipped with one and go up anchor clamps movable block 3 about last anchor clamps 4, last anchor clamps 4 with about the semi-circular shape of last anchor clamps movable block 3 formation on two limits.
The standing part of semi-circular shape and the movable part of semi-circular shape form a circle, movable part is positioned at the top of standing part, the concentric circles projection 2-2 of lower clamp movable block 2 is stuck in the anchor clamps movable block 3 concentric circles grooves, and the concentric circles projection of last anchor clamps movable block 3 is stuck in the lower clamp movable block 2 concentric circles groove 2-3.
Operation principle of the present utility model and using method are: standing part is fixed on the support, movable part is connected on the cylinder, cylinder drives movable part and moves up and down, when needs clamp petroleum pipeline, movable part moves downward, engaging between lower clamp movable block 2 and concentric circles projection above the last anchor clamps movable block 3 and the concentric circles groove, guaranteed that the standing part of semi-circular shape and the movable part of semi-circular shape form a circle, and the center of circle of two parts overlaps, guaranteed the clamping force all directions of petroleum pipeline port all identical, movable part moves upward when needs take out petroleum pipeline, standing part separates with movable part, the movable block projection guarantees to go up anchor clamps movable block 3 with last anchor clamps 4 motions, limited impression 2-1 can be used for limiting the range of movement of anchor clamps movable block 3, the bascule of lower clamp movable block 2 makes when petroleum pipeline takes out more convenient.
